Player Story

Tavaris Harrison story

Tavaris Harrison built his college career from 2016 through 2019 as a wide receiver from North Miami, FL wearing No. 82, spending time with Florida Atlantic. The clearest part of Tavaris Harrison's career was his receiving role: 80 catches, 1,272 receiving yards, and 3 touchdowns across 38 career games in the available record. His career also includes 2 tackles, giving the story more than a single-category snapshot.
